Transaction 759da3f76ca7bd5f3940e8ae0a8c55c14262abe4ee4e255819759ad6e2ddd9bf

1 Input
2 Outputs
  • 759da3f76ca7bd5f3940e8ae0a8c55c14262abe4ee4e255819759ad6e2ddd9bf:0
  • value  2870601
    address  35MLnjDCyFsQ3GnyeCzVTkU4z8G8YUCXs2
  • 759da3f76ca7bd5f3940e8ae0a8c55c14262abe4ee4e255819759ad6e2ddd9bf:1
  • value  23549783
    address  3LfdxjxZodEJeTSid6uxS1cpmakd1hkDwA